Ugandan Firm Seeks $130M for Cancer Drugs After Halting COVID Vaccine Project
The founder of Dei BioPharma has announced the company is seeking $130 million from investors to complete a $1.1 billion investment plan for manufacturing key drugs for non-communicable diseases like cancer, heart disease, and acute kidney failure.
